Recognizing the Value of Quality Sleep


Quality rest is vital for both physical and psychological well-being. It affects every little thing from cognitive function to emotional law. Recognizing the relevance of rest can help people identify warning signs that they might require to consult a sleep expert.


The Scientific research of Rest


Rest is a complex biological process that enables the body to recuperate and regenerate. Throughout rest, the mind cycles via various phases, including REM (rapid-eye-movement sleep) and non-REM rest. Each phase serves certain features, such as memory consolidation, emotional processing, and physical repair work.


Hormones play a vital duty in managing rest. For instance, melatonin assists indicate the body to get ready for rest, while cortisol levels fluctuate throughout the day to advertise alertness. Disturbances to this equilibrium can cause sleep wake disorders, which can impair total wellness.


In addition, persistent sleep problems can aggravate existing wellness conditions, including cardio problems and diabetics issues. Understanding these organic processes highlights why maintaining high-quality rest is crucial for long-term health and wellness.


Impacts of Rest Deprival


Rest deprival can considerably prevent bodily features. Individuals frequently experience lowered cognitive capabilities, consisting of impaired memory and decision-making. This psychological fog can influence productivity and raise the danger of accidents.


Literally, absence of sleep damages the immune system, making one even more susceptible to health problem. It can also result in weight gain, as rest deprivation impacts hormonal agents that manage appetite, motivating overeating.


Emotional health and wellness endures as well. Inadequate rest is related to increased stress and anxiety, clinical depression, and state of mind swings. Recognizing the signs of rest starvation is crucial; consistent problems might demand consulting a sleep specialist for effective treatment choices.

Kinds Of Sleep Disorders


Rest problems include a series of conditions that can substantially impact a person's lifestyle. Acknowledging the certain type of problem is vital for efficient therapy and management.


Sleep Problems and Related Issues


Sleep problems is characterized by difficulty falling or remaining asleep. It can be acute or chronic, with causes varying from anxiety and anxiety to medical conditions. People may experience daytime exhaustion, irritation, and problem concentrating.


Relevant issues consist of sleep beginning sleeplessness, where individuals have a hard time to drop off to sleep, and maintenance sleeplessness, which includes waking often during the evening. Treatment alternatives can consist of cognitive behavior modification and drugs like benzodiazepines or non-benzodiazepine sleep aids. Way of living adjustments, such as establishing a constant sleep timetable, can also benefit those struggling with insomnia.


Sleep-Related Breathing Conditions


Sleep-related breathing conditions, such as obstructive rest apnea (OSA), entail disruptions in breathing during rest. OSA happens when throat muscles loosen up excessively, obstructing the respiratory tract. This problem can bring about interrupted sleep and reduced oxygen degrees, affecting overall wellness.


Signs and symptoms might consist of loud snoring, gasping for air throughout rest, and extreme daytime drowsiness. Diagnosis generally includes a sleep research study. Treatment frequently consists of way of life adjustments, such as weight-loss, and making use of continual favorable airway pressure (CPAP) tools. Sometimes, surgical procedure might be needed to remove cells blocking the respiratory tract.


Circadian Rhythm Sleep-Wake Disorders


Body clock sleep-wake disorders occur when an individual's internal body clock is misaligned with their exterior atmosphere. Usual types include delayed rest phase disorder and shift job condition. The former leads to late rest beginning and wake times, while the last affects those functioning non-traditional hours.


Symptoms frequently consist of insomnia and excessive daytime sleepiness. Taking care of these problems may entail light treatment, melatonin supplements, or readjusting rest routines. Preserving a regular sleep regimen can significantly assist in aligning one's circadian rhythm.


Parasomnias and Therapy Alternatives


Parasomnias are disruptive sleep conditions that involve uncommon actions throughout rest. Typical types include sleepwalking, sleep speaking, and evening terrors. These episodes can cause injuries and substantial distress for the affected individual and their family.


Therapy for parasomnias frequently focuses on making certain risk-free sleep atmospheres and taking care of anxiety. Behavioral therapy can be reliable, together with medicines in many cases to decrease episodes. Recognizing triggers and keeping a normal sleep routine can likewise decrease events of parasomnia, enhancing the overall rest experience.



Identifying Rest Disorders


Identifying sleep problems includes a systematic strategy that normally begins with a detailed consultation and might include various specialized tests. Recognizing the signs and symptoms and obtaining the best info is essential for effective treatment.


Appointment with a Rest Professional


During the very first meeting with a sleep specialist, the client offers an in-depth medical history. This consists of rest patterns, way of living behaviors, and any kind of existing medical conditions.


The doctor may ask inquiries such as:



  • How many hours of rest do you get each night?

  • Do you experience daytime tiredness?

  • Exist any substantial way of living adjustments just recently?


Based upon the information gathered, the specialist might think about differential medical diagnoses. A health examination could adhere to, concentrating on indications of sleep problems, such as obesity or uneven breathing patterns during rest.


Rest Researches and Tests


If necessary, the sleep professional might advise more assessment through sleep studies, typically known as polysomnography. This examination documents brain task, oxygen degrees, heart price, and breathing throughout sleep.


An additional option is home sleep apnea testing, which permits people to monitor their sleep in a comfy atmosphere. This entails using mobile tools to track snoring, air movement, and blood oxygen levels.


In some cases, additional lab examinations may be bought to check for relevant conditions, such as thyroid concerns. These examinations assist in determining the root cause of sleep disturbances and overview therapy intends properly.



Treatment and Monitoring of Rest Disorders


Efficient treatment and management of rest problems entail a mix of behavioral adjustments, medicines, and long-term strategies customized to private needs. Identifying the underlying reasons is critical for identifying the most suitable approach.


Behavior and Lifestyle Changes


Carrying out behavioral modifications can dramatically boost rest quality. This consists of maintaining a consistent sleep timetable, going to sleep and waking up at the same time day-to-day. Creating a relaxing environment by reducing sound and light can also improve sleep.


Encouraging leisure methods, such as mindfulness or reflection, assists prepare the mind for sleep. Limiting high levels of caffeine and pure nicotine intake, particularly in the mid-day and evening, adds to much better rest hygiene. Workout, while promoting basic health, can additionally improve rest patterns, though it is finest not to engage in strenuous task near bedtime.


Medications and Therapies


When way of living modifications alone do not be enough, drugs may be suggested. Common prescription options include hypnotics and sedatives designed to assist people fall asleep and stay asleep. Antidepressants might additionally be useful for those with underlying mood conditions affecting sleep.


Cognitive Behavior Modification for Sleeplessness (CBT-I) is one more efficient treatment. This organized program targets thoughts and behaviors that influence rest. It has actually confirmed efficient in helping clients develop much healthier rest habits without the need for long-lasting medicine.


Long-Term Monitoring Approaches


Lasting management is important for chronic rest problems. Routine follow-up appointments with a rest professional make sure that treatment continues to be efficient and changes are made as required. Keeping a rest diary can assist track patterns and identify triggers influencing sleep.


Education and learning concerning rest health is additionally important. Understanding rest cycles and the effect of way of living choices equips patients to make educated choices. Support groups can provide added sources and inspiration, promoting a sense of area for people dealing with comparable obstacles.



Preventative Steps and Great Rest Health


Developing effective sleep health and producing a perfect sleep atmosphere are crucial for improving sleep quality and general health and wellness. Details methods can considerably influence exactly how well one sleeps in the evening.


Creating an Optimum Sleep Setting


A favorable rest setting promotes relaxation and boosts sleep quality. Keep the room best website cool, ideally between 60-67 ° F(15-20 ° C), to help with a comfy sleeping temperature level.


Darkness is crucial; think about using blackout drapes or an eye mask to shut out light, which can assist signal the body that it is time to rest.


Reducing noise is another crucial element. Usage earplugs or a white noise device if required. The bed mattress and pillows need to give appropriate support and comfort, aiding to stay clear of discomfort that can disrupt rest.


Healthy And Balanced Sleep Habits and Routines


Establishing constant sleep practices help in regulating rest cycles. Going to bed and waking up at the same time on a daily basis, even on weekend breaks, assists keep a constant internal clock.


Engaging in relaxing activities prior to bedtime, such as reading or exercising deep-breathing workouts, can signify to the body that it's time to wind down. Limiting screen time from gadgets at the very least an hour prior to rest additionally reduces direct exposure to blue light, which can hinder rest.


Furthermore, preventing high levels of caffeine and heavy meals close to going to bed supports better sleep. Regular physical activity during the day can also promote much deeper sleep, as long as it's not also close to going to bed.
